Key Differences In Between Payment Bonds and Auto mechanic's Liens
When determining between settlement bonds and auto mechanic's liens, it's essential to recognize the vital differences to make an enlightened choice. Settlement bonds are generally gotten by the job proprietor to make certain that subcontractors and distributors are spent for the work they have actually finished. On the other hand, auto mechanic's liens are a legal claim versus the residential or commercial property by a specialist, subcontractor, or vendor who hasn't been spent for work done on that home.
Repayment bonds offer protection to subcontractors and suppliers if the general contractor fails to make payments as promised. On the other hand, mechanic's liens use a way for professionals and suppliers to protect repayment by putting a case on the home where the work was carried out. Payment bonds are usually acquired before job starts, while auto mechanic's liens are filed after non-payment issues develop.

Variables to Consider Before Picking
Consider different important variables prior to choosing either a payment bond or a mechanic's lien to guard your interests in a building job.
Firstly, analyze the job size and complexity. For bigger projects with several events entailed, a settlement bond might supply broader defense contrasted to a technician's lien, which could be more suitable for smaller tasks.
Second of all, review the economic stability of the celebrations included. If there are issues about the contractor's economic wellness, opting for a payment bond can provide an included layer of security.
Third, think about the timeline of the task. Technician's liens generally entail a longer legal process, so if you require quicker resolution in case of non-payment, a repayment bond might be the far better selection.
Finally, evaluate the legal requirements in your state pertaining to settlement bonds and auto mechanic's liens to ensure conformity.
